548 (DXLVIII) was a leap year starting on Wednesday of the Julian calendar, the 548th year of the Common Era (CE) and Anno Domini (AD) designations, the 548th year of the 1st millennium, the 48th year of the 6th century, and the 9th year of the 540s decade. As of the start of 548, the Gregorian calendar was 2 days ahead of the Julian calendar, which was the dominant calendar of the time.

Events

By place

Africa

  • Battle of the Fields of Cato - Byzantines under John Troglita crush Moorish revolt

Births

  • Xiao Zhuang

Deaths

  • June 28 Theodora, Byzantine empress
  • Carcasan, king of the Ifuraces
  • Theudis king of the Visigoths
  • Theodebert I, king of Austrasia (or 547)
